Singapore, like many other advanced economies, has a relatively low, and declining, birth-rate. One consequence of this, and a consequence also of the successful economy, is that migrants are being drawn in, and are becoming an increasing proportion of the overall population. This book examines this crucial development, and assesses its likely impact on Singapore society, politics and the state. It shows that, although Singapore is a multi-ethnic society, migration and the changing ethnic mix are causing increasing strains, putting new demands on housing, education and social welfare, and changing the make-up of the workforce, where the government is responding with policies designed to attract the right sort of talent. The book discusses the growing opposition to migration, and explores how the factors which have underpinned Singapore’s success over recent decades, including a cohesive elite, with a clearly focused ideology, a tightly controlled political system and strong continuity of government, are at risk of being undermined by the population changes and their effects. The book also compares the position in Singapore with other East Asian countries, including Japan, South Korea and the Philippines, which are also experiencing population changes with potentially far-reaching consequences.

What do the sounds of a chorus of tropical birds and frogs, a clap of thunder, and a cacophony of urban traffic have in common? They are all components of a soundscape, acoustic environments that have been identified by scientists as a combination of the biophony, geophony, and anthrophony, respectively, of all of Earth’s sound sources. As sound is a ubiquitous occurrence in nature, it is actively sensed by most animals and is an important way for them to understand how their environment is changing. For humans, environmental sound is a major factor in creating a psychological sense of place, and many forms of sonic expression by people embed knowledge and culture. In this book, soundscape ecology pioneer Bryan C. Pijanowski presents the definitive text for both students and practitioners who are seeking to engage with this thrilling new field. Principles of Soundscape Ecology clearly outlines soundscape ecology’s critical foundations, key concepts, methods, and applications. Fundamentals include concise and valuable descriptions of the physics of sound as well as a thorough elucidation of all sounds that occur on Earth. Pijanowski also presents a rich overview of the ecological, sociocultural, and technical theories that support this new science, illustrating the breadth of this amazingly transdisciplinary field. In methods, he describes the principles of data mining, signal processing, and mixed methods approaches used to study soundscapes in ecological, social, or socio-ecological contexts. The final section focuses on terrestrial, aquatic, urban, and music applications, demonstrating soundscape ecology’s utility in nearly all spaces.

Nas últimas décadas, os países em desenvolvimento ricos em recursos têm utilizado os seus recursos naturais como garantia colateral para ter acesso a fontes de financiamento para o investimento, contrabalançando assim as barreiras com que se deparam no acesso a empréstimos bancários convencionais e a mercados de capital. Um dos modelos de financiamento que surgiu desta situação foi o modelo de Infraestruturas Financiadas por Recursos (RFI), uma adaptação dos anteriores modelos de empréstimos garantidos pelo petróleo promovidos por vários bancos ocidentais em à?frica. Num acordo de RFI, o empréstimo para a construção de uma infraestrutura é titularizado pelo valor actual líquido de um fluxo de receitas futuras provenientes da extracção de petróleo ou de minerais. O modelo tem sido aplicado em vários países africanos, num valor contratual cumulativo de cerca de USD 30 000 milhões, de acordo com fontes à disposição do público. Depuis quelques dizaines d’années, les pays en développement riches en ressources naturelles utilisent ces dernières en tant que garanties pour obtenir accès à des sources de financement pour leurs investissements et contourner les obstacles qu’ils rencontrent lorsqu’ils s’efforcent d’obtenir des prêts traditionnels auprès des banques ou des capitaux sur les marchés financiers. Différents modèles de financement sont issus de ces efforts, parmi lesquels le modèle des infrastructures financées par des ressources naturelles (IFR) qui est une variante des modèles de prêts garantis par le pétrole lancés en Afrique par plusieurs banques occidentales. Dans le cadre d’une transaction basée sur le modèle des infrastructures financées par des ressources naturelles (IFR), un prêt contracté pour financer la construction immédiate d’une infrastructure est garanti par la valeur actuelle nette de flux de revenus qui seront générés à l’avenir par l’extraction d’hydrocarbures ou de minerais. Le modèle a été employé dans plusieurs pays africains pour des contrats d’une valeur totale de l’ordre de 30 milliards de dollars, selon des informations publiques.
